CSS中有很多技巧可以将两个元素横向排列在同一行,一般可使用float属性实现,也可以使用flexbox布局等现代技术。以下是两种常见的实现方式:/* 第一种方式,使用float */ .box {
CSS中有很多技巧可以将两个元素横向排列在同一行,一般可使用float属性实现,也可以使用flexbox布局等现代技术。以下是两种常见的实现方式:
/* 第一种方式,使用float */ .box { width: 100%; } .box div { float: left; width: 50%; } /* 第二种方式,使用flexbox */ .box { display: flex; } .box div { flex: 1; }
以上两种方式都能实现将两个元素排列在同一行,具体选择哪一种实现方式则取决于需求和场景。需要注意的是,使用float属性时需要自己清除浮动,而使用flexbox则不需要。
粉丝
0
关注
0
收藏
0